クラウドの力 インターネットが支える未来のコンピューティング

クラウドコンピューティングに関する質問

ITの初心者

クラウドコンピューティングの利点は何ですか?

IT・PC専門家

クラウドコンピューティングの主な利点には、コスト削減、スケーラビリティ、さらにはリモートアクセスの容易さが含まれます。ユーザーは必要なリソースを必要なときにだけ利用できるため、初期投資を抑えることが可能です。また、データがオンラインに保存されているため、いつでもどこからでもアクセスできる利便性があります。

ITの初心者

クラウドサービスのセキュリティは大丈夫ですか?

IT・PC専門家

クラウドサービスのセキュリティは適切に管理されていますが、利用者自身がパスワードを強化することや二要素認証を導入するなど、自己防衛策を講じることも非常に重要です。信頼できるプロバイダーを選ぶことも、セキュリティを確保するためには欠かせません。

クラウドコンピューティングとは何か?

クラウドコンピューティングは、インターネットを介してデータやアプリケーションを提供する仕組みであり、ユーザーは自身のデバイスに依存することなく、どこからでも必要な情報やサービスにアクセスすることができます。

具体的には、クラウドコンピューティングはインターネットを活用して、データやアプリケーションを提供するサービスを指します。従来は、個々のユーザーが自分のコンピュータにソフトウェアやデータを保存していたのに対し、クラウドコンピューティングではこれらのリソースを外部のサーバーに保存し、インターネットを通じてアクセスできるようにします。これにより、物理的なストレージデバイスの限界に縛られず、必要なときに必要なだけのリソースを使うことができるのです。また、バックアップやソフトウェアの更新が自動的に行われるため、ユーザーは常に最新の状態でサービスを利用可能です。多くのビジネスや個人がこの技術を活用しており、例えばGoogle DriveやDropboxのようなオンラインストレージサービス、またはMicrosoft AzureやAWSなどのクラウドプラットフォームがその一例です。このように、コスト削減や高い柔軟性、スケーラビリティを得られることから、クラウドコンピューティングは現代のIT環境において欠かせない基盤となっています。

インターネットの基本的な仕組み

インターネットは、世界中のコンピュータを互いに接続する巨大なネットワークです。情報の送受信は、データパケットという小さな単位で行われ、プロトコルに従って処理される仕組みになっています。この理解が、ITの基礎を築く重要なステップとなります。

インターネットは、コンピュータやスマートフォンなどのデバイス同士が接続され、情報をやり取りするためのグローバルなネットワークです。その基盤には通信を行うためのプロトコルがあり、特に「TCP/IP」と呼ばれるプロトコルが広く利用されています。データは特定の形式で「データパケット」として小さな単位に分割され、送信先のアドレス情報と共にネットワークを通じて送信されます。

インターネット上では、デバイス同士が直接接続されるのではなく、ルーターやスイッチなどのネットワーク機器を介して情報が分配されます。ルーターは受信したデータを解析し、最適な経路を選んで送信する役割を果たしています。この仕組みにより、インターネットは非常に柔軟かつ効率的に情報を流通させることが実現されています。

さらに、ドメイン名システム(DNS)によって、意味のある文字列(例:www.example.com)がIPアドレスに変換され、ユーザーが簡単にウェブサイトにアクセスできる仕組みが整っています。インターネットの基本的な仕組みを理解することで、より高度なIT技術やクラウドコンピューティングの概念を学ぶための第一歩を踏み出すことができるのです。

クラウドコンピューティングが生まれた背景

クラウドコンピューティングは、インターネットの普及とテクノロジーの急速な進化により誕生しました。これにより、データやアプリケーションを集中管理し、どこからでもアクセスできるようになりました。

クラウドコンピューティングは、インターネットの進化とコンピュータ技術の発展から生まれたものです。特に1990年代以降、インターネットが商業利用されるようになり、データの送受信が迅速かつ効率的に行えるようになったことが大きな要因として挙げられます。また、企業がデータやIT資源を自社で全て管理することが難しくなり、コスト削減や柔軟性のニーズが高まりました。さらに、仮想化技術の進化により物理的なサーバーを効率的に利用できるようになり、リソースの共有が現実のものとなりました。このような環境の整備が進んだ結果、クラウドサービスが登場し、ユーザーはインターネットを通じて必要なサービスやリソースに簡単にアクセスできるようになったのです。今日では、ビジネスから日常生活に至るまで、あらゆる場面でクラウドが活用され、利便性を提供しています。クラウドコンピューティングは、ITインフラの管理を簡素化し、個人や企業が必要なときに必要な分だけ利用できる新たな仕組みを生み出しています。

インターネットとクラウドコンピューティングの関係

インターネットはクラウドコンピューティングの基盤を提供し、クラウドサービスはインターネットを通じてデータやアプリケーションにアクセスできるため、場所を選ばずに利用可能です。

インターネットとクラウドコンピューティングは非常に密接に関連しています。インターネットは、世界中のコンピュータやデバイスが通信するためのネットワークを提供します。一方で、クラウドコンピューティングはインターネットを利用してリモートサーバーにデータやアプリケーションを保存し、必要に応じてアクセスする技術です。このため、クラウドサービスを利用する際には必ずインターネットへの接続が必要不可欠です。クラウドは物理的なハードウェアやインフラを持たずにデータを保存し、管理する柔軟性を提供します。これにより、企業や個人は高価な設備投資をせずに、スケーラブルなサービスを受けることができるのです。さらに、インターネットを通じてリアルタイムでデータが更新されるため、常に最新の情報にアクセスできる環境が整っています。このように、インターネットはクラウドコンピューティングの成長を支える重要な要素となっています。

クラウドサービスの種類と利用方法

クラウドサービスは、遠隔のサーバーを活用してデータを保存または処理する方法であり、代表的なサービスにはIaaS、PaaS、SaaSの3つがあります。それぞれのサービスについて詳しく解説します。

クラウドサービスは主に3つの種類に分類されます。まず、IaaS(Infrastructure as a Service)は、サーバーやストレージを提供するサービスです。ユーザーは必要なリソースを選択して利用できるため、運用にかかる費用を抑えることが可能です。次に、PaaS(Platform as a Service)は、アプリケーションを開発するための環境を提供しており、開発者はインフラ管理を気にせず、プログラミングに専念できるのが特徴です。

最後に、SaaS(Software as a Service)は、インターネットを通じてソフトウェアを提供するサービスであり、例えばオンラインで利用できるメールやオフィスソフトがこれに該当します。多くの場合、サブスクリプションモデルが採用されており、必要な時に必要なだけ利用できる点が魅力です。

これらのクラウドサービスを利用する方法は、各サービスの提供元のウェブサイトからアカウントを作成し、希望するプランを選ぶことが一般的です。自身のビジネスや目的に応じて最適なサービスを選択することで、効率的な運用が実現できます。

クラウドコンピューティングの利点と課題

クラウドコンピューティングは、データやアプリケーションをインターネット経由で利用する技術であり、利点にはコスト効率やスケーラビリティがありますが、同時にセキュリティや依存性といった課題も存在します。

クラウドコンピューティングの利点は主にコスト削減と利便性です。企業はサーバーやインフラを自前で所有する必要がなく、必要な分だけをサービスとして利用することができます。また、スケーラビリティが高く、需要に応じてリソースを柔軟に増減させることができるため、ビジネスの成長に対して迅速に対応することが可能です。さらに、どこからでもアクセスできるため、リモートワークやチームでの協力も容易になります。

一方で、クラウドコンピューティングにはいくつかの課題も存在します。最も大きな課題の一つはセキュリティです。データがオンラインで保存されるため、ハッキングや情報漏洩のリスクが常に付きまといます。また、クラウドサービス提供者に依存するため、サービスが停止した場合の影響が大きい点も懸念されています。さらに、データの移行やプラットフォームの変更に伴う複雑さも考慮する必要があります。これらの利点と課題を理解し、自社における活用方法を模索することが大切です。

タイトルとURLをコピーしました